Wings Over Gaylord-2011 @ Gaylord Regional Airport!
Friday 17 June
MEDIA/SPONSOR DAY
Noon to 4:00 p.m. Media and Sponsors meet the performers and crews.
HANGAR PARTY #1 (WW II/1940s theme) 7:00 - 11:00 EAA sponsored Hangar party, Step back in time with the live big band sound of Glenn Miller, Tommy Dorsey and many others and watch or join in yourself as the hangar deck turns into a dance floor. A tremendous hit at the 2010 air show you won't want to miss. Cost is $10.00 per person. Open to the public, theme attire welcome but not required – food, beer, wine and soft drinks available for purchase.
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Saturday 18 June
AIR SHOW (Gates open at 9:00 a.m. to the public)
Noon - 4:00 p.m. Jaw dropping Aerobatic aerial performances, Jets and vintage war birds performing and on display
HANGAR PARTY #2 (Saigon Rock Night) 7:00 p.m. - 11:00 p.m. NEW in 2011, The Kiwanis sponsored Hangar party, Transport yourself to the era of the Rolling Stones and the Mommas and Poppas with the Live Rock sound of the 1960's and 70's. Help us recognize and pay tribute to our Viet-Nam Veterans in our USO Show themed hangar party. It will no doubt be the event not to miss. Cost is $10.00 per person. Open to the public, theme attire welcome but not required – food, beer, wine and soft drinks available for purchase
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Sunday 19 June
AIR SHOW (Gates open at 7:00 a.m. to the public)
7:00 a.m. - 11:00 a.m. EAA sponsored Pancake Breakfast
Noon - 4:00 p.m. Jaw dropping Aerobatic aerial performances, Jets and vintage war birds performing and on display
5:00 p.m. - Wings Over Gaylord 2011 closes
Farmer's Market Under The Pavilion
The Gaylord Downtown Farmers Market is considered one of the finest markets in northern Michigan!
Michigan farm producers sell fresh fruits and vegetables, baked goods, herbs, and much more under the downtown pavilion.
In the warmer months, you’ll also find outdoor plants and flowers.
Ample parking is available.
Open every Saturday, 8:00 am to 2:00 pm, May 28 through October 29. And every Wednesday, 8:00 am to 2:00 pm, July through October.
Don't miss the Downtown Gaylord Thanksgiving Farmers Market! November 23, 10:00 am to 2:00 pm.

Photography Show
Robert deJonge "One-Man Photography Show" will be on display at the Gaylord Community Arts Center, 125 E. Main Street from June 4 through July 1, with a reception on Saturday June 11 from 4-5:30. With 30 years experience as a professional photographer and designer, Mr. deJonge's work will add unique beauty and style to our downtown gallery.

Michigan Murder & Mayhem - Author Tom Henderson
Michigan Murder & Mayhem, Michigan True Crime Author Tom Henderson will speak at the Library on Saturday, June 18th at 6:30pm.
Tom Henderson's new book recounts the true store of a stay-at-home dad, his high-powered wife, and his jealousy that drove him to murder. Northern Michigan was captivated by the manhunt that ended with his capture in an Emmet County park.
